Problem solved!

It was the cps=crankshaft position/speed sensor.The heat coming from the sump caused the sensor to fail.It was ok when driving because the wind cooled it down.But when stopped and parked the heat made it fail=no spark.Actually it was quite easy to check.I just let the car idle so that it cut out.Then cooled the cps with compressed air and after that it started properly.I did the test couple of times just to make sure it was not just coincidence.
